Here are some personal details and bio data for Christopher Wallace:

DetailInformation
Full NameChristopher George Latore Wallace
BornMay 21, 1972
BirthplaceBrooklyn, New York, U.S.
DiedMarch 9, 1997 (aged 24)
OccupationRapper, Songwriter
Years Active1992–1997
Associated ActsBad Boy Records, Junior M.A.F.I.A.
